Sri Dharmegowda vs Sri Srinivas And Others

High Court Of Karnataka|23 February, 2017
|

JUDGMENT / ORDER

HIGH COURT LEGAL SERVICES COMMITTEE, BENGALURU BEFORE THE LOK ADALAT IN THE HIGH COURT OF KARNATAKA AT BENGALURU DATED THIS THE 23RD DAY OF FEBRUARY, 2017 CONCILIATORS PRESENT:
THE HON’BLE MR. JUSTICE B. VEERAPPA & SRI. ARVIND KAMATH, MEMBER M.F.A.No. 6712/2015 (MV) (Lok Adalat No. 5367/2016) BETWEEN Sri. Dharmegowda S/o Late Karigowda, Aged about 37 years, Resident of Haralahalli Village, Kasaba Hobli, Holenarasipura Taluk-573 211. ... APPELLANT (By Sri. Chethan B., Advocate) AND 1. Sri. Srinivas S/o Javaregowda, Major, Resident of Hebbur Village, Haradanahalli Post, K.R. Nagar Taluk, Mysore – 571 602.
2. The Manager, Royal Sundaram General Insurance Co. Ltd., Head Office: 46, Whites Road, Chennai – 600 014.
Represented by the Branch Manager, Royal Sundaram General Insurance Co. Ltd., No.133, 3rd Floor, Shikha Towers, Ramavilas Road, Mysore – 570 023. ... RESPONDENTS (By Sri. Ravi S. Samprathi, Advocate for R-2, Notice to R-1– d/w v.c.o. dated 25.11.2016) MFA FILED U/S 173(1) OF MV ACT AGAINST THE JUDGMENT AND AWARD DATED 13.07.2015 PASSED IN MVC NO. 1818/2013 ON THE FILE OF THE SENIOR CIVIL JUDGE AND JMFC AND MACT, HOLENARASIPURA, PARTLY ALLOWING THE CLAIM PETITION FOR COMPENSATION AND SEEKING ENHANCEMENT OF COMPENSATION.
THIS APPEAL COMING ON FOR CONCILIATION BEFORE LOK ADALATH, AFTER BEING REFERRED BY THE COURT, THE FOLLOWING CONCILIATION ORDER IS PASSED.
CONCILIATION ORDER The learned Counsel for the claimant-appellant and the learned Counsel for the respondent – Royal Sundaram General Insurance Co. Ltd. along with its representative are present.
2. After prolonged negotiations, the matter is settled. The appellant - Claimant has agreed to receive and the Respondent – Insurance Company has agreed to pay a lump sum of Rs. 1,50,000/- (Rupees One Lakh Fifty Thousand only), in addition to what has been awarded by the Tribunal, in full and final settlement of the claim. A joint Memo is filed on behalf of the parties to this effect.
3. The Respondent – Insurance Company has agreed to deposit the said amount before the Tribunal within six weeks from the date of preparation of award, failing which the said amount shall carry interest at the rate of 9% P.A. from the date of default, till the date of deposit.
4. Out of the enhanced compensation amount, a sum of Rs.50,000/- shall be deposited in fixed deposit in the name of the appellant in any Nationalized / Scheduled Bank for a period of three years with liberty to withdraw the interest periodically. The remaining compensation of Rs.1,00,000/- shall be released in favour of the appellant on proper identification.
5. This Miscellaneous First Appeal stands disposed of in terms of the Joint memo. The Judgment and Award of the Tribunal shall stand modified accordingly. Draw up the Award accordingly.
